ALEXANDRIA, Va., Sept. 15 -- United States Patent no. 12,737,688, issued on Sept. 15, was assigned to NEC Corp. (Tokyo).

"Predicting values for a multitude of time series with target and input variables connected in a graph" was invented by Tobias Jacobs (Heidelberg, Germany) and Ammar Shaker (Heidelberg, Germany).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A computer-implemented method for training a machine learning-artificial intelligence model for multiple prediction tasks includes inputting data for tasks and additional data sources through a common trainable task representation function to obtain a data representation for each.
